Output 58df1a8fe9b5043609a56952bd07ee30742dea93c3937e2f44adc87460e9bbea:0
- value
- 22362607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7a3312dbe2b3397b7ee2bf601c56b5ea7fc8528 OP_EQUAL
- address
- 3MMChaDS9GqxpHyCEFmxGDvA5ZL5bneoyu
- transaction
- 58df1a8fe9b5043609a56952bd07ee30742dea93c3937e2f44adc87460e9bbea
- confirmations
- 229481
- spent
- true